In March 2022, the United Nations Environmental Assembly met in Nairobi, Kenya, to deliberate on world plastic waste. To combat plastic waste, 175 countries would support a new goal plastic treaty. The countries agreed to hasten the process so that the treaty would take effect as early as 2025.

Progress of Negotiations

The fifth meeting of the Intergovernmental Negotiating Committee to create an international law that will protect sea life from plastic waste (INC-5). It began in Busan, Republic of Korea. After the four rounds of negotiations conducted already, namely INC-1 held in Punta del Este November 2022, INC-2 conducted in Paris June 2023, INC-3 conducted in Nairobi November 2023, and INC-4 held in Ottawa April 2024, the fifth round, INC-5, is set to end the negotiation and to approve the agreement’s text.

Challenges Faced

The negotiations in Busan failed for a number of reasons. Here are some challenges faced by the global plastic treaty:

  1. One of the most controversial issues was whether the treaty should set clear goals for lowering the amount of plastic produced worldwide.
  2. Many nations, especially those that support the High Ambition Coalition, believe that reducing plastic manufacture is crucial to successfully addressing pollution at its source.
  3. A group of oil-producing countries, such as Russia and Saudi Arabia, were against any parts of the deal that would limit output.

Implications for India

India is a significant source of plastic pollution worldwide. Besides, the country is in a crucial yet challenging position during the Global Plastic Treaty negotiations. Now, it is responsible for about 20% of the world’s plastic waste, so its position has a big effect on how well the deal might work.

India strongly opposes a ban on polymer production, saying that such action would go against the UNEA’s decision. However, India has asked for more useful rules based on national needs and adaptable to local situations. Besides, the country wants the deal to include financial and technical help. It believes that the right means and sharing of technology are needed to handle plastic waste properly.

Conclusion

The primary goal of the Global Plastic Treaty is to put an end to plastic waste across the globe by 2040 and reduce its negative impacts on health and the environment. One of its biggest goals is to get rid of single-use plastics. The treaty also aims to make less plastic, promote greener options, and make makers more responsible for handling the whole life cycle of plastics.

Besides, many people are working for the treaty to cover a wide range of known health issues connected to plastic in the environment. Plus, it includes exposure to harmful chemicals, microplastics in food and water, air pollution from burning plastic, and endocrine disruptors.
